Elo Pay 22″ Tap to Pay Expands Compatibility for Self-Service Kiosks
Industry: Advertising & Marketing
Fully integrated contactless payment with a 22-inch Android touchscreen and Stripe’s Tap to Pay on Android solution enables seamless transactions and enhanced checkout customization.
Knoxville, TN (PRUnderground) October 24th, 2024
Launched on August 1st, the all-new Elo Pay 22” touchscreen is a powerful self-service kiosk that allows a wide array of merchants to accept contactless payments with ease. Now, Elo is excited to announce that the touchscreen is compatible with Stripe’s Tap to Pay on Android solution and can be set up on each kiosk in minutes for users who have enabled Tap to Pay with Stripe.
The innovative 22” touchscreen has been created to maximize user experience, allowing customers to quickly and easily interact with the self-service kiosk, creating an engaging and efficient encounter with every transaction. Designed to be highly versatile, the all-in-one payment system caters to a wide range of needs, from ordering and ticketing to check-in, making it ideal for use across a broad range of industries.
Now, Elo is taking the innovative touchscreen further with compatibility with Stripe’s Tap to Pay on Android solution This will allow merchants to accept contactless payments to be accepted in-person via American Express, Mastercard, and Visa contactless cards as well as NFC-based mobile wallets such as Apple Pay, Google Pay, Samsung Pay, and more.
This compatibility will allow merchants to create a unified commerce experience across their online and in-person customer interactions. Merchants will also not need to buy, set up, or manage any additional hardware, such as dedicated card readers, to start accepting payments through the Elo Pay 22” touchscreen. Setup takes only a few moments per kiosk, ensuring businesses can benefit from the partnership almost immediately.
“With contactless payments now the norm for many consumers, we are really pleased to be working with Stripe to ensure our new Elo Pay 22” touchscreen allows merchants to accept a wide range of payments with ease,” said Neeraj Pendse, vice president of Product Management at Elo. “Our mission has always been to create a smooth experience for merchants and customers, and now brands can have greater control to customize their in-store checkout to reflect their brand and customer experience with on screen ‘Tap to Pay’.”

About Elo
Elo, now part of Zebra Technologies, is a global leader in interactive solutions that power digital experiences at the point of engagement. With more than 35 million installations across over 80 countries, Elo helps organizations connect with customers and employees through reliable, purpose-built touch technology. Built on a unified architecture, Elo’s portfolio spans touchscreen computers, monitors, open-frame displays, payment devices, peripherals, and cloud-based device management, supporting applications from point-of-sale and self-service to digital signage and healthcare. In fact, a new Elo touchscreen is installed somewhere in the world every 21 seconds. Learn more at EloTouch.com.
